Bbuddah Hoga Terra Baap makes it to Oscars library

Looks
like
all
the
dreams
of
director
Puri
Jagannath
is
being
heard
by
a
fairy.
First
he
got
to
direct
his
childhood
idol,
actor
Amitabh
Bachchan
in
the
film
Bbuddah
Hoga
Terra
Baap
and
now
the
script
of
the
film
has
made
its
way
to
The
Academy
of
Motion
Pictures
and
Arts
archives
at
Los
Angeles.
Puri,
who
is
thrilled
with
this
continuous
success,
expresses
to
DNA,
“Imagine,
first
Mr
Bachchan
says
yes
and
I
get
to
make
a
film
with
him.
Then,
I
get
a
call
from
the
Oscars
archives.
It
is
like
a
double
whammy.
I"m
just
so
glad
with
the
way
things
turned
out."
Puri
also
exclaimed
that
he
got
the
good
news
from
none
other
than
Mega
star
Amitabh
Bachchan.
The
director
say,
“He"s
my
idol
and
he"s
my
lucky
charm
as
well
now." The
director,
however
is
not
at
rest,
after
his
successful
venture
into
Bollywood
with
Bbuddah
Hoga
Terra
Baap,
this
Telugu
filmmaker
is
busy
with
his
South
projects.
Puri
is
busy
making
Businessman,
starring
Mahesh
Babu
and
Kajal
Aggarwal.
